Hotel Description

Arheilger Hof is a charming and low-key hotel located at Guerickeweg 16, 64291 Darmstadt, Germany. This inviting establishment is situated just a 6-minute walk from the Darmstadt–Arheilgen train station, offering convenient access to both local and regional transport options. Guests can enjoy a relaxing stay with easy access to the vibrant surroundings, including the quirky Waldspirale residential complex, only 4 km away, and the Hessisches Landesmuseum Darmstadt, which is 7 km from the hotel. Andrea Palunbo

1/5
Very nice welcome and clean. However, the rooms/furniture are very outdated and no longer suitable for a hotel. Silicone mold in the shower, barrier hinge broken out, two different beds and mattresses, etc. The price-performance ratio (€110 per night without breakfast) is not right.

Sandro Albano PULVERIT

3/5
The hotel left a lasting, if not positive, impression on me.The hotel is reasonably priced, so you shouldn't expect too much, but just a little more.PositiveThe breakfast service is okay. The room is a decent size. There is a charging station for electric vehicles.NegativeUnfortunately there was only one charging station, which was also occupied by the hotel itself. The response was quick, but perhaps a second station would make sense in this case. On the way to my room I noticed a very unpleasant smell of cigarettes. Unfortunately, this smell also penetrated my room, definitely not pleasant for a non-smoker. The furniture in the room is past its best, the mattress is pretty sagging. There's also a problem with cleanliness... massive amounts of hair on the floor (from the previous guest?), mold in the shower and silverfish on the wall. Last but not least, the hotel is located in the approach area of ​​the airport.

Jakub Sochor

1/5
I have to say that I have not been in such a bad hotel for a long time. Location in the middle of an industrial area - why not, at least it's close to the train station, it's not a major problem (although the honking of police cars or listening to drifting from the adjacent parking lot is a bit disturbing at night). But the basic problem is the cleaning - the hotel and the individual rooms are dirty and, for example, the dust was wiped only once in two months. Hoovering is also only occasionally and I am not even talking about any deeper cleaning of the room. Bed bugs, cockroaches, spiders - you'll find everything in the rooms and you won't bring it home with a little luck. The kitchen is very small and with only a minimum of equipment, you have to ask for a change of cloth, as well as soap or detergent; but you have to buy the sponges with your own money. After all, everything that could be charged in the hotel is charged. I am surprised that there is no charge for coffee for the breakfast, which is quite poor. In general, with the staff, you get the feeling that you are really getting in the way there.Waste water regularly flows out of the bathroom and kitchen, especially on the lower floors, a real treat. The garages also have a warehouse for all kinds of waste and discarded cars. A true beauty. Like the bathrooms, which are not ventilated, so your towel won't dry there until the next day - if you put it in your room to dry - you will get a warning that it is forbidden!I will summarize it simply - if you have the option of staying in another hotel, do it.
